    They are no injector ID'S so with that in mind coupled with the fact they are quite large I think they are the reason why my idle isn't perfect. My idle bounces around a bit more than it should within the high 14's and even a brief poke on low 15's on occasion. That could also be attributed to a vacuum leak, exhaust leak etc..but I've done enough testing to make sure those are ruled out. If you want to avoid adding a 7th injector down the road then I'd get the 80lbs over the 61lbs. Unless you desire the cooling effect from the 7th. I was boosted with a rotrex when I went with the 80's. The rotrex being wayy more efficient along with a large intercooler I felt I didn't need the cooling from a 7th but would rather benefit from the more even fuel distribution of larger injectors.
    Scott simply selects the size of injectors within the software and it proportionally adjusts fuel to the injectors size so no custom tune needed.

    Injectors Dynamics - top of the line injectors. Core wise starts out as a Bosch but much superior to it's identical looking sibling. Flow tested and ported to have much better spray pattern for atomization. Most tuners beg you to run them to avoid idling issues and ease of tuning with high powered machines.
